Metcalfe County High School is a higher-need, mid-sized high school in Edmonton, Kentucky, enrolling 454 students.
Class loads run somewhat heavier than typical: 16.8:1 puts it in the larger third of Kentucky schools by student-teacher ratio.
Economic need runs somewhat above the state's typical profile, with 65.4% of students eligible for free meals.
With 454 students, its enrollment sits close to the Kentucky median campus size.
Its Resource Investment Index trails 94% of the 1,389 Kentucky schools with a score on record, one of the lower results on this measure.
Among 489 similarly sized, similarly resourced-need Kentucky schools statewide, it ranks #457, in the lower tier once campus size and economic need are matched.
Its student body is predominantly White (93% of enrollment) (diversity index 13/100).
On the academic-pipeline side it reports 4 Advanced Placement courses.
Counselor access is stretched at roughly 454 students per counselor, well above the ASCA-recommended 250:1 ceiling.
Chronic absenteeism is elevated: 38.5% of students missed 10% or more of school days (2021-22 Civil Rights Data Collection).
Its district draws 22.4% of revenue from federal sources, an above-typical federal share that tends to track a higher-need student population.
Discipline events run high: 166 in- and out-of-school suspensions were reported for 454 students in the 2021-22 Civil Rights Data Collection.
Metcalfe County also operates Metcalfe County Elementary School (648 students) and Metcalfe County Middle School (310 students) alongside Metcalfe County High School.
